So I was just about to go post on the Cloupor Mini thread and I said to myself "you don't NEED any of this s^&t". Anybody else catch themselves?

I keep catching myself. I really don't NEED another device now. But unfortunately, I don't trust my iStick or Cloupor DNA30s (until I rebuild them). Many manufacturers are coming to market with new "Mini" devices. Some are more mini than others. Besides the Cloupor Mini, (BIG) iPv Mini and (Expensive) SX Mini; Sigelei and SMOK are putting new minis on the market.

The Sigelei has 30W & 50W "mini" devices upcoming. The 30W is 90mm x 36mm x 22mm, with 18650. I can't find many details on the 50-watter. But it looks bigger than the 30W. SMOK has two of their three new minis on their website: Xpro M22 (22W) & Xpro M50 (50W). A video has also shown an Xpro M36 (36W). All three SMOKS are 85mm x 38mm x 22mm. The M22 & M36 have built-in 1900 mAh LiPo batts. The M50 has an 18650. I haven't seen MSRP or wholesale prices yet on any of these.

Unless there's a death in my MOD family, I'll wait until all the new mini devices are in market with reviews & customer feedback. The iStick was my first "early adoption". I'll try to focus on mature products from now on. You know, like 2-3 months old. :laugh:
